A Historic Island Retreat with Modern Flair

The Ferry Inn stands as a welcoming beacon in the village of Uig, located on the rugged northern tip of the Isle of Skye’s Trotternish Peninsula. This 19th-century inn has been lovingly maintained and enhanced to provide a blend of historic charm and contemporary style. The building’s cozy interiors are thoughtfully curated, featuring a mix of textures, warm lighting, and tasteful decor that evokes the spirit of the Scottish Highlands while offering modern comforts.

Accommodations with a View and Personal Touches

The inn offers three beautifully appointed rooms, each designed with attention to detail and comfort. Guests enjoy spectacular views over Uig Bay, immersing themselves in the island’s natural beauty. Rooms are enhanced with thoughtful amenities such as welcome drams of whisky, snacks, fresh milk, and local maps, creating a home-away-from-home atmosphere. The personal care from the family owners adds to the intimate, inviting experience.

A Culinary Destination Celebrated for Excellence

The Ferry Inn’s restaurant is renowned for its exceptional small plates menu, showcasing the best of local and seasonal produce. The food presentation is artful and flavors are carefully balanced, with standout dishes like scallops paired with black pudding crumb and bacon jam. The dining experience is intimate, often with limited seating that fosters a warm, convivial atmosphere. The inn’s bar complements the restaurant with a lively yet cozy vibe, perfect for enjoying a dram or local ale.

Warm Hospitality Rooted in Family Tradition

Run by a dedicated family, The Ferry Inn is noted for its friendly and attentive service. The owners and staff create a welcoming environment where guests feel valued and cared for. This familial approach extends beyond service to the inn’s overall atmosphere, making it a beloved spot among locals and visitors alike. The presence of the resident Westie dog adds a charming, homely touch.

Setting for Exploring the North Isle of Skye

Situated close to the ferry quay, The Ferry Inn is ideally positioned for travelers exploring the northern reaches of Skye. Its location offers easy access to iconic landscapes such as the Quiraing and the Old Man of Storr, making it a perfect base for nature lovers and adventurers. The village of Uig itself provides a quaint and peaceful backdrop, enhancing the inn’s tranquil yet lively character.
